HAVERHILL — Stephen G. "Chief" Twombly Sr., 58, of Haverhill, died Tuesday, Dec. 8, 2009 at the Parkland Medical Center in Derry.
He was born in Haverhill, Oct. 15, 1951 son of the late Milton and Frances (Ryan) Twombly.
Educated in the Haverhill school system, Mr. Twombly graduated from Haverhill High School, Class of 1970. For over 27 years he was employed as a process analyst at Western Electric/AT&T/Lucent Technologies.
More recently he was a security guard at Haverhill High School, was a constable and Justice of The Peace.
An avid sports fan, especially football, he coached Haverhill High School freshman football for many years was a member of the Haverhill Touchdown Club, and the Haverhill Stadium Committee. Mr. Twombly also coached baseball for Haverhill Little League and Haverhill American Legion.
His survivors include his wife of five years, Barbara A. (McAdams) Twombly of Haverhill; three sons, Stephen G. Twombly Jr. and his wife Kristine of North Andover, Christopher W. Twombly of Bradford, Ryan P. Twombly of E. Hampstead, N.H.; two brothers, Edward Twombly of Florida, Milton Twombly Jr. of Haverhill; a sister, Donna Cheney of Lawrence; two grandchildren, Jack and Ty Twombly; and several nieces and nephews. Mr. Twombly was also the brother of the late Patricia Merrick.
